Abstract

Le modele de choix de portefeuille developpe et utilise a des fins de prevision par le pole epargne de FOE est elabore a partir de l'estimation de l'encours de chaque actif financier detenu par les menages par un modele a correction d'erreur sur la periode 1978-1995. En dehors des effets d'arbitrage traditionnels et de l'influence de variables reglementaires, nous insistons plus particulierement sur la deformation progressive des portefeuilles faisant suite aux nombreuses innovations de produits financiers au cours de la periode d'etude.
